Runbook: Veldmark template rendering slow (>800ms p95). First check the partial cache hit rate on the render tier; below 70% means the warmer cron died — restart it. If cache is fine, look for oversized context payloads from the Quillbox CMS sync; anything over 2MB gets serialized per-request and tanks latency. Mitigation: enable the compiled-template fallback flag and drain one node at a time. Do not flush the whole cache during peak. Confirm you are on the trace below before escalating.

build token for kagaf-hahof: htk14_9d3d4d26d7d8de

**Action Item 4 (owner: docs-platform):** During the Orvette incident, the Scribelint pipeline silently skipped validation on any page exceeding its internal buffer cap, allowing an unreviewed policy page to publish. From a security standpoint this is a fail-open path: oversized content bypassed link and classification checks entirely. We will convert the skip into a hard block, emit an audit event, and pin the limits in version control so reviewers can diff changes. The constants under review are as follows.

constants for tageg-kagag:
QUOTAS = {
    "kelax": 495,
    "istath": 366,
    "tammir": 108,
    "novdor": 730,
    "casax": 816,
    "quenael": 874,
    "pelius": 403,
}

Before approving changes to the threshold, note that the check distinguishes between a missing file and a zero-byte placeholder, which Quillhaven sometimes uploads during their maintenance windows — only the former should page. The parser in drop_monitor.py handles both cases; please review the retry logic carefully. Questions about the alert's routing should go to the integrations desk at the address below.

escalation mailbox, yajeg-bageg: quenax.olidor@lumiccorp.internal

Step 4: Migrating the TideGlass widget to the Harborline v3 API. Before merging, verify that the widget now requests tide tables through the regional endpoint rather than the deprecated station poller. The response schema changed: high/low events arrive as a flat array with ISO timestamps, so the grouping logic in `tide_rows.ts` was rewritten accordingly. Please check the timezone handling for the Port Merrow fixtures carefully, since the old code assumed local offsets. The service must be started with the following configuration values.

service settings:
WENATH_LOG_LEVEL=debug
WENATH_METRICS_HOST=metrics.wenath.norvalabs.internal
WENATH_POOL_SIZE=16